Can we appreciate the level of detail in the animations and them paying attention to the ammo-types/caliber
The game has really nice details. My favorite being the sequential reload animations. If you empty a mag, replace it with new mag and didnt rack the bolt back because you cancelled the reload (by sprinting for example). When you continue the reload it only racks the bolt back. Instead of older games where the whole reload was 1 animation of 1.2 secs for example. It now has multiple short sequences of animations which all advance to certain stage making the sequential reloading possible.
